Recommended Model
NVIDIA Jetson Orin Nano
The latest and most capable entry-level Jetson for edge AI development:
- CPU: 6-core Arm Cortex-A78AE v8.2 64-bit CPU
- GPU: 1024-core NVIDIA Ampere architecture GPU
- AI Performance: 40 TOPS (Tera Operations Per Second)
- Memory: 8GB 128-bit LPDDR5 (68 GB/s)
- Storage: microSD card slot + M.2 Key M slot
- Connectivity: Gigabit Ethernet, USB 3.2, USB 2.0, MIPI CSI-2
- Power: 7W - 15W configurable TDP
Legacy Option: Jetson Nano 4GB
Note: The original Jetson Nano 4GB will work for basic edge applications, but it has been discontinued by NVIDIA. We recommend the Jetson Orin Nano for new projects due to significantly improved performance and ongoing support.

What's Included
The Jetson Orin Nano Developer Kit includes:
In the Box
- Jetson Orin Nano Module: Pre-mounted on carrier board
- Reference Carrier Board: With all essential I/O connectors
- WiFi Module: 802.11ac dual-band wireless
- Thermal Solution: Heat sink and fan for cooling
- Quick Start Guide: Getting started documentation
Additional Requirements
You'll need these components to get started:
- MicroSD Card: 64GB+ Class 10/UHS-I (128GB recommended)
- USB-C Power Supply: 5V/3A (15W) power adapter
- HDMI Cable: For display connection
- USB Keyboard and Mouse: For initial setup
- Ethernet Cable: For network connectivity (optional with WiFi)
Key Features for Edge Computing
AI and Machine Learning
- CUDA Cores: Full CUDA support for GPU acceleration
- TensorRT: Optimized inference engine for production deployment
- cuDNN: Deep learning primitives library
- JetPack SDK: Complete development environment
Computer Vision
- OpenCV: Optimized computer vision library
- VisionWorks: NVIDIA's computer vision and image processing library
- Multiple Camera Support: Up to 4 cameras via MIPI CSI-2
- Hardware Acceleration: Dedicated video encode/decode engines
Connectivity and I/O
- GPIO: 40-pin expansion header compatible with Raspberry Pi
- USB: Multiple USB 3.2 and USB 2.0 ports
- Ethernet: Gigabit Ethernet for reliable networking
- WiFi/Bluetooth: Integrated wireless connectivity
- M.2 Slot: For NVMe SSD storage expansion
Getting Started
Once you have your Jetson Orin Nano:
- Flash JetPack: Download and install the latest JetPack SDK
- Initial Setup: Complete the Ubuntu setup wizard
- Update System: Install latest packages and updates
- Install Development Tools: Set up your AI/ML development environment
- Test GPU: Verify CUDA installation and GPU functionality
